WebApr 2, 2024 · Respiratory distress syndrome (RDS) is a condition that causes breathing problems in newborns. This condition is also called hyaline membrane disease. It may start within minutes to hours after your baby is born. It is most common in premature infants because their lungs may not be fully developed. WebIt happens when the baby’s lungs haven’t developed enough to be able to take in enough oxygen. Babies in the womb start to produce a substance called surfactant, which helps to keep the lungs inflated and stops them collapsing at the end of each breath. Most babies’ lungs have produced enough surfactant by 34 weeks of pregnancy. WebRDS occurs when there is not enough surfactant in the lungs. Surfactant is a liquid made by the lungs that keeps the airways (alveoli) open. This liquid makes it possible for babies to … WebA newborn's normal breathing rate is about 40 times each minute. This may slow to 20 to 40 times per minute when the baby is sleeping. CS can have major health impacts on your baby. How CS affects your baby’s health depends on how long you had syphilis and if — or when — you got treatment for the infection. CS can cause: • Miscarriage (losing the baby during pregnancy), • Stillbirth (a baby born dead), or • Death shortly after birth. imerys apprenticeships
